What is Kyushu Electric Power's market cap?
Kyushu Electric Power (9508) has a market capitalization of approximately ¥846.0B, trading at ¥1789.50 on the JPX. Market cap moves with the live share price.
What is Kyushu Electric Power's P/E ratio?
Kyushu Electric Power's trailing twelve-month P/E ratio is 5.8x, with a price-to-book (P/B) of 0.7x. Valuation multiples are best compared with Utilities sector peers rather than read in isolation.
How profitable is Kyushu Electric Power?
Kyushu Electric Power runs a net profit margin of 6.8%, a gross margin of 13.6%, and an operating margin of -9.2%. Margins and ROE indicate how efficiently the business converts sales into profit and shareholder returns.
How much revenue does Kyushu Electric Power generate?
Kyushu Electric Power reported revenue of ¥2.25T for fiscal year 2026, with net income of ¥153.5B and earnings per share (EPS) of 314.65. SniperIQ tracks the full 8-quarter revenue and margin trend on the research dashboard.
Does Kyushu Electric Power pay a dividend?
Kyushu Electric Power offers a trailing dividend yield of about 2.8%. Dividend sustainability depends on payout ratio, free cash flow, and earnings stability — all tracked in SniperIQ's fundamentals view.
Is Kyushu Electric Power financially healthy?
Kyushu Electric Power carries a debt-to-equity ratio of 3.12x and a current ratio of 0.77x, with a market beta of 0.22. Lower leverage and a current ratio above 1.0 generally signal a stronger balance sheet.
